Movies Logo
Mirror World

Mirror World

Shan Shan, a kind-hearted girl, falls ill unexpectedly while participating in an extra-curricular activity with her classmates. Her sister ventures into a science experiment to save her, and eventually sacrifices herself.

Where to Watch

Stream, buy or rent this movie from the providers below.

Stream
Not available
Buy
Not available
Rent
Not available